Nathaniel Phillips has more chance of leaving Liverpool in January than Joe Gomez amid interest from West Ham.

That is the view of former Spurs and England number one Paul Robinson, speaking exclusively to Football Insider about Phillips, 24, potentially swapping Anfield for the London Stadium.

The Hammers are expected to enter the winter market for a centre-half following injuries to Angelo Ogbonna and Kurt Zouma.

An Irons source told Football Insider (29 November) that West Ham are lining up a move for Liverpool’s Phillips.

The Sunday Mirror have reported (5 December p.71) that the Reds will block Joe Gomez from leaving in January amid interest from Aston Villa.

However, this site understands Jurgen Klopp’s side will listen to offers for Phillips, who is behind Gomez in the pecking order at Anfield.

When asked by Football Insider‘s Dylan Childs for his thoughts on Phillips potentially joining the Irons, Robinson said:

“Phillips has got more chance of leaving than Gomez has, that’s for sure.

“I still think a deal will be difficult to do though given the injury crisis Liverpool had last season.

“Phillips was brilliant at the end of last season but whether he is of the same level as Zouma and Ogbonna, I would question that.

“It’s an area that Moyes probably need to address though.”

As quoted by Football.London (4 December), David Moyes remained coy when quizzed about potential centre-back signings in January.

He said: “January is far away. We have a game next week before we get to January.”
